BIOGRAPHY

Roberto Camardiel was a distinguished Spanish actor whose career spanned several decades, leaving an indelible mark on film and theater. He is perhaps best known for his role in the influential Spaghetti Western "Arizona Colt" (1966), a film that has become a staple among collectors of the genre. This film not only showcases Camardiel's talent but also exemplifies the stylistic shifts in cinema during the 1960s, making it a sought-after title for those who appreciate the evolution of Westerns on home video. In addition to his iconic role in "Arizona Colt," Camardiel's performances in "Culpables" and "Bajo el cielo andaluz" (1960) further solidified his reputation in Spanish cinema. His accolades, including the Premio Nacional a la Mejor Interpretación Principal Masculina in 1964, highlight his significant contributions to the industry. What are some notable films featuring Roberto Camardiel?

Some notable films include Arizona Colt (1966) where he played Whiskey, Adiós Gringo (1965) as Dr. Verne Barfield, and For a Few Dollars More (1965) as the Tucumcari Station Clerk.
